
At Jin's encore fan concert, members of BTS appeared one after another, beautifully decorating the finale. Jin held "#RUNSEOKJIN_EP.TOUR_ENCORE" at Incheon Munhak Stadium on October 31 and November 1, concluding the fan concert tour that started in June. He sang 18 songs for about 150 minutes, showcasing his presence as a solo artist. On this day, he made a surprise appearance not from the main stage but from the stadium track, singing his solo album's title track "Running Wild" and "I'll Be There" while running around. The opening was a production born from Jin's idea, symbolizing the concert name "Run, Seokjin," conveying a message of "running close to you" and marking the completion of his journey back to Korea after the world tour. Jin expressed, "I prepared the encore performance with the feeling of decorating the finale. I will cut the finish tape in Incheon together with ARMY. I want you to run with me until the end." New stages unique to the encore concert were also unveiled. Jin performed "The Truth Untold (feat. Steve Aoki)" while playing the piano and sang his first solo song "Awake" for the first time in about eight years, which had not been performed since the 2017 "BTS LIVE TRILOGY: EPISODE III THE WINGS TOUR," filling the venue with enthusiastic cheers. The concert featured various segments to interact with fans, such as guessing words from audience gestures in "Communicate, ARMY" and guessing titles from audience singing in "Sing, ARMY." Surprise appearances by BTS members were also a major highlight of the concert. On the first day, J-HOPE and Jungkook appeared, energetically performing "Super Tuna" with Jin. On the second day, V joined the stage. J-HOPE and Jungkook said, "We came to celebrate Jin's encore fan concert. We will show you our enjoyment on stage," while V teared up, saying, "I really wanted to see this scene. Thinking of standing with all seven of us made me emotional." Each member also performed their solo songs: "Killin' It Girl (Solo Version)" (J-HOPE), "Standing Next to You" (Jungkook), and "Love Me Again" (V), with Jimin joining in on the second day for a surprise opening. Throughout both days, they performed a BTS medley leading to "IDOL," "So What," and "My Universe." Jin shared, "While preparing for this performance, I naturally united with the members after a long time. We will visit you as a group in even more wonderful forms in the future," and conveyed his sincerity, saying, "The voices of ARMY completed this performance. I will continue to believe in you until the end. I will do my best to sing while looking at ARMY until the end." During the encore stage, he boarded a hot air balloon resembling "Wootteo" (a character related to Jin's 2022 solo single "The Astronaut") and interacted with the audience while circling the stadium. Despite the stadium being larger than the concert in Goyang in June, the production reflected Jin's desire to connect more closely with fans. The audience added to the performance with enthusiastic cheers and surprise events. In "Nothing Without Your Love," colorful flashlights spread like waves, and in "Moon," fans expressed their love for Jin by holding up paper shaped like the moon. Amidst the fireworks illuminating the sky and the cheering voices, Jin and ARMY became one in spirit. At the end of the concert, the screen displayed the title "#RUNSEOKJIN_EP.TOUR THE MOVIE" along with the words "DECEMBER COMING SOON," hinting at a new chapter for "Run, Seokjin" and raising audience expectations to a peak. This concert was structured as an extension of Jin's original content "Run, Seokjin," enhancing storytelling by integrating episodes of "Run, Seokjin" with VCR and stage production according to the atmosphere of each song. The concert concluded with a moving finale amidst vibrant fireworks and the audience's enthusiastic cheers.
BTS member Jin and chef Baek Jong-won are facing legal scrutiny after their agricultural company was accused of violating origin labeling laws. The issue arose from products labeled as 'domestic' despite using foreign ingredients. They have stated that they complied with regulations but acknowledged a labeling error during online sales.

BTS members Jimin and Jungkook will host All Night Nippon X on December 5, celebrating their travel variety show 'Are You Sure?!' Season 2 on Disney+. This marks their return to the show since June 2023. The program will feature their travel experiences and favorite BTS songs. Assistant Masaki Furuya will join them.
'#RUNSEOKJIN_EP.TOUR THE MOVIE', capturing BTS Jin's first solo concert tour, will be released nationwide on January 2, 2026. The film includes performances from his albums 'Happy' and 'Echo', behind-the-scenes footage, and a special greeting video for fans. Tickets will be available in December.

A Japanese woman in her 50s was charged with sexual assault for forcibly kissing BTS member Jin during a fan event in Seoul. The incident occurred after Jin's military service at the '2024 FESTA' festival, leading to a police investigation initiated by BTS fans. The woman voluntarily reported to the police, resulting in her indictment.
